From: Emerging role of non-coding RNAs in the regulation of KRAS
circRNAs | Diseases | Pattern of expression | Samples | Cell lines | Targets/regulators | Signaling pathways | Function | References |
---|---|---|---|---|---|---|---|---|
FAT1; HIPK3; ARHGAP; MAN1A2; RHOBTB3; RTN4; SMARCA5 | Colon cancer | Down | – | DLD-1, DKO-1 cells, DKs-8 cells | KRAS | – | circRNAs may serve as promising cancer biomarkers | [74] |
circITGA7 | Colorectal cancer | Down | 69 pairs of colorectal cancer samples and ANTs | s (SW480, RKO, Caco-2, SW620, LoVo, HCT116 and DLD1 | ITGA7 | Ras pathway | circITGA7 represses the proliferation and metastasis of CRC cells via inhibiting the Ras signaling pathway and inducing the transcription of ITGA7 | [73] |
Circ_GLG1 | Colorectal cancer | Up | 40 pairs of CRC tissues and ANTs | HCT116, SW620, and DLD1 cells | miR-622 | Ras pathway | circ_GLG1 promoted tumor cell viability, proliferation, invasion, and migration | [72] |
circFNTA | Bladder cancer | Up | 41 cancer tissues and matched ANTs | SVHUC, BCa cell lines T24, J82, 5637, and UMUC3 | miR-370-3p | Ras pathway | circFNTA induced cell invasion and cisplatin chemo-resistance | [75] |
Circ-MEMO1 | Non-small cell lung cancer | Up | 52 pairs of SCLC tissue samples and ANTs | H1650, PC9, H1299, and A549 | miR-101-3p | miR-101-3p/KRAS Axis | Circ-MEMO1 induced the progression and aerobic glycolysis of lung cancer cells | [76] |
